The advice is found under the general recommendations section of Intel’s wireless advice page.

It states: “Unfortunately, the 2.4 GHz spectrum is very limited on how many channels are available, and conflicts arise quickly.

“Updating to a Wireless-AC router may be required to increase your speeds and reduce wireless drops.”

Most Wi-Fi routers have two communication bands.

These are 2.4GHz and 5GHz.

If you find you only have 2.4GHz, it might be time for an upgrade.

Generally, the 2.4GHz band is better for getting a good connection the further away you are from your router.

The 5GHz band offers much higher speeds at a lower range or distance.

However, it’s best to have the option of using both so you can change between them.

You may even have a 6GHz band on a new router.

Within these bands are different channels you can switch to.

You’ll find some channels are busier than others if you look at your router’s online admin page.

Picking a channel that all your neighbors aren’t using can increase your Wi-Fi speed.
